Used for heat prevention of pipes and thermal protection of cables and wires.
■Common maximum heat resistance temperature: 370℃, maximum heat resistance temperature: 540℃. ■Uses very thin, continuous amorphous silica threads. ■A tube woven from bundles of 6-micron thin threads in a plain weave. ■Manufactured from inorganic materials, no hazardous gases are generated. ■Used for heat prevention of pipes and thermal protection of cables and wires. ■Tube wall thickness: 0.16mm, 0.32mm. ■Tape inner diameter: various sizes starting from a minimum of 13mm (varies with thickness). ■Sold in roll units (length of the roll varies with thickness and inner diameter). ■Non-asbestos product.

Applications/Examples of results
Prevention of heat radiation and burns from boiler piping and pipes, thermal protection for cables, cords, and wires, protection from welding sparks for cables and cords, etc.
